Fees and Cost Over Time
FTNY charges 0.36% per year while SCHD charges 0.06%. On a $10,000 position that is $36 vs $6 annually, a gap of $30 per year that compounds over a long holding period. On income, FTNY currently yields 2.80% against 3.31% for SCHD.
